Stade Rennais FC is closely monitoring Lassine Sinayoko, the forward from AJ Auxerre, who is also being pursued by RC Lens and Olympique de Marseille. With one year left on his contract, Sinayoko could leave Auxerre this summer after a convincing season. The 26-year-old Malian player has caught the attention of several Ligue 1 clubs, and his versatile profile could appeal to coaches. Marwan Belkacem, a well-known insider among Marseille supporters, recently mentioned potential negotiations between OM and Sinayoko. He expressed his belief that OM could be in talks to recruit the Auxerre captain. Sinayoko's performances, which have shown his ability to shine even in difficult situations, make him a highly sought-after player.
